Are you worried about your online presence? Do you want to scrub yourself from search results and achieve some privacy? Well, you're not alone. Many people are demanding ways to reduce their digital footprint. The good news is that there are techniques you can implement to go more invisible online.
First, let's explore the basics of search engine results pages (SERPs). When you search something online, search engines like Google index billions of web pages to show the most relevant results. Your personal information, like your name, address, and social media profiles, can appear in these results if it's publicly viewable.
Here are some measures you can take to minimize your online presence:
* Review Your Online Accounts: Start by identifying all the accounts you have registered. This encompasses social media profiles, email addresses, online forums, and any other platforms where you share.
* Secure Your Privacy Settings: Once you understand your accounts, change the privacy settings to control who can view your information.
* Delete Unnecessary Accounts: If there are accounts you no longer use, deactivate them. This will help to reduce the amount of personal data that is publicly available.
By following these recommendations, you can take steps to minimize your online presence and secure a greater sense of privacy. Remember, it's an ongoing process, so remain aware about the latest privacy tools.
